NEI scientists use retinal connectomics to study color vision circuitry relevant for mood, myopia

A 3D map was developed showing the neural circuitry of S-cone photoreceptors, important for perceiving blue light

*

National Institutes of Health (NIH) researchers have constructed a 3D map of neural circuitry of S-cone photoreceptors, a . . .
